Joe Miller gave an opening prayer and welcomed the Grace Honduras Mission Home Team to the meeting.

Kathleen McClelland, who is serving as Grace’s medical person, provided the team with some general medical information including, among other things, possible illnesses and diseases, prevention and treatment, shots, pills, safety and protection, and food/drink cautions.

The team then heard from its activity team leaders:

Greta Miller stated that the school programs/books/hygiene committee is progressing nicely with crafts, bible lessons, and other programs;

Theresa Cipriano stated that the Home Kits for nearly 70 families would be approximately $20 per kit. Theresa will present a "Minute for Mission" at next Sunday’s church service to show the congregation a sample home kit and advise and encourage everyone that they can "sponsor" a home kit;

The suitcase committee headed by Kim Hatfield related that it appears that members have generously donated enough suitcases;

Judy Reiske advised that circles were contacted and to date they have provided two suitcases full of sewing supplies;

Erik Hawkins reported that he is working on getting supplies for the Fiesta; and

Joe Miller related that the well project is on hold pending arrangements with the Honduran government and its water authority. More information is needed, and when known, the congregation will be advised.

Greta Miller then provided the team with a quick overview of what personal supplies were needed for the trip to Honduras and what one may want to consider packing including, but not limited to, four changes of clothes, gloves, hygiene pack, hat, backpack, water container, journal, long sleeve shirt, loose and lightweight pants, and heavy soled shoes. Greta then closed the meeting with prayer.

The next meeting of the Grace Honduras Team will be on Saturday, July 6, 2002, at 2:00 p.m. for packing day.
